70% to passIn accordance with the international MARPOL Annex VI regulations, which of the listed substances are prohibited from being burned in a shipboard incinerator?
ARefined petroleum products containing detergent additives.
BGarbage containing trace amounts of heavy metals.
COil residue and sewage waste sludges.
DRefined petroleum products containing halogen compounds.
AI Explanation
The correct answer is D) Refined petroleum products containing halogen compounds. The MARPOL Annex VI regulations prohibit the incineration of refined petroleum products containing halogen compounds, as they can release toxic and environmentally harmful substances when burned.
